Direct Medial Entorhinal Cortex Input to Hippocampal CA3 Is Crucial for eEF2K Inhibitor-Induced Neuronal Oscillations in the Mouse Hippocampus
The hippocampal formation plays a vital role in memory formation and takes part in the control of the default neuronal network activity of the brain.
